Uses of Class
org.aspectj.weaver.ReferenceType
-
Packages that use ReferenceType Package Description org.aspectj.weaver org.aspectj.weaver.bcel org.aspectj.weaver.ltw org.aspectj.weaver.reflect -
-
Uses of ReferenceType in org.aspectj.weaver
Subclasses of ReferenceType in org.aspectj.weaver Modifier and Type Class Description classArrayReferenceTypeclassBoundedReferenceTypeclassTypeVariableReferenceTypeFields in org.aspectj.weaver declared as ReferenceType Modifier and Type Field Description protected ReferenceType[]BoundedReferenceType. additionalInterfaceBoundsstatic ReferenceType[]ReferenceType. EMPTY_ARRAYprotected ReferenceTypeAbstractReferenceTypeDelegate. resolvedTypeXMethods in org.aspectj.weaver that return ReferenceType Modifier and Type Method Description static ReferenceTypeTypeFactory. createParameterizedType(ResolvedType aBaseType, UnresolvedType[] someTypeParameters, World inAWorld)ReferenceTypeReferenceType. findDerivativeType(ResolvedType[] typeParameters)static ReferenceTypeReferenceType. fromTypeX(UnresolvedType tx, World world)ReferenceType[]BoundedReferenceType. getAdditionalBounds()ReferenceTypeReferenceType. getGenericType()ReferenceTypeResolvedType. getGenericType()ReferenceTypeAbstractReferenceTypeDelegate. getResolvedTypeX()ReferenceTypeReferenceTypeDelegate. getResolvedTypeX()ReferenceTypeTypeVariableReferenceType. getUpperBound()ReferenceTypeWorld. lookupBySignature(String signature)ReferenceTypeWorld. lookupOrCreateName(UnresolvedType ty)ReferenceTypeWorld. resolveToReferenceType(String name)Methods in org.aspectj.weaver with parameters of type ReferenceType Modifier and Type Method Description voidReferenceType. checkDuplicates(ReferenceType newRt)protected abstract ReferenceTypeDelegateWorld. resolveDelegate(ReferenceType ty)voidResolvedMemberImpl. setDeclaringType(ReferenceType rt)voidReferenceType. setGenericType(ReferenceType rt)Constructors in org.aspectj.weaver with parameters of type ReferenceType Constructor Description AbstractReferenceTypeDelegate(ReferenceType resolvedTypeX, boolean exposedToWeaver)BoundedReferenceType(ReferenceType aBound, boolean isExtends, World world)BoundedReferenceType(ReferenceType aBound, boolean isExtends, World world, ReferenceType[] additionalInterfaces)GeneratedReferenceTypeDelegate(ReferenceType backing) -
Uses of ReferenceType in org.aspectj.weaver.bcel
Methods in org.aspectj.weaver.bcel that return ReferenceType Modifier and Type Method Description ReferenceTypeBcelWeaver. addClassFile(UnwovenClassFile classFile, boolean fromInpath)Methods in org.aspectj.weaver.bcel with parameters of type ReferenceType Modifier and Type Method Description BcelObjectTypeBcelWorld. buildBcelDelegate(ReferenceType type, JavaClass jc, boolean artificial, boolean exposedToWeaver)ReferenceTypeDelegateTypeDelegateResolver. getDelegate(ReferenceType referenceType)static List<AjAttribute>AtAjAttributes. readAj5ClassAttributes(AsmManager model, JavaClass javaClass, ReferenceType type, ISourceContext context, IMessageHandler msgHandler, boolean isCodeStyleAspect)protected ReferenceTypeDelegateBcelWorld. resolveDelegate(ReferenceType ty) -
Uses of ReferenceType in org.aspectj.weaver.ltw
Methods in org.aspectj.weaver.ltw with parameters of type ReferenceType Modifier and Type Method Description protected ReferenceTypeDelegateLTWWorld. resolveDelegate(ReferenceType ty)protected ReferenceTypeDelegateLTWWorld. resolveIfBootstrapDelegate(ReferenceType ty) -
Uses of ReferenceType in org.aspectj.weaver.reflect
Methods in org.aspectj.weaver.reflect that return ReferenceType Modifier and Type Method Description ReferenceTypeJava15ReflectionBasedReferenceTypeDelegate. buildGenericType()ReferenceTypeReflectionBasedReferenceTypeDelegate. buildGenericType()ReferenceTypeReflectionBasedReferenceTypeDelegate. getResolvedTypeX()Methods in org.aspectj.weaver.reflect with parameters of type ReferenceType Modifier and Type Method Description static ReflectionBasedReferenceTypeDelegateReflectionBasedReferenceTypeDelegateFactory. create14Delegate(ReferenceType forReferenceType, World inWorld, ClassLoader usingClassLoader)static ReflectionBasedReferenceTypeDelegateReflectionBasedReferenceTypeDelegateFactory. createDelegate(ReferenceType forReferenceType, World inWorld, Class<?> clazz)static ReflectionBasedReferenceTypeDelegateReflectionBasedReferenceTypeDelegateFactory. createDelegate(ReferenceType forReferenceType, World inWorld, ClassLoader usingClassLoader)voidJava15ReflectionBasedReferenceTypeDelegate. initialize(ReferenceType aType, Class aClass, ClassLoader classLoader, World aWorld)voidReflectionBasedReferenceTypeDelegate. initialize(ReferenceType aType, Class<?> aClass, ClassLoader aClassLoader, World aWorld)protected ReferenceTypeDelegateReflectionWorld. resolveDelegate(ReferenceType ty)Constructors in org.aspectj.weaver.reflect with parameters of type ReferenceType Constructor Description ReflectionBasedReferenceTypeDelegate(Class forClass, ClassLoader aClassLoader, World inWorld, ReferenceType resolvedType)
-